Alpena, Michigan vs Bakersfield, Ca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Alpena, Michigan, Usa and Bakersfield, Ca, Usa is approximately 3,166 km or 1,968 mi.
  • To reach Alpena, Michigan in this distance one would set out from Bakersfield, Ca bearing 59.3°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Alpena, Michigan bearing 82.7° or E .
  • Alpena, Michigan has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Bakersfield, Ca has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Alpena, Michigan is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Bakersfield, Ca is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 12.6 °C (22.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 7.2 °C (13°F) more in Alpena, Michigan.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 587.2 mm (23.1 in) more which is equivalent to 587.2 l/m² (14.41 US gal/ft²) or 5,872,000 l/ha (627,756 US gal/ac) more. About 5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.7° lower in Alpena, Michigan than in Bakersfield, Ca.
